Wat Kang is a small, serene Buddhist temple located in the northern part of Vang Vieng, Laos. Known for its traditional Lao architecture and peaceful atmosphere, it offers a tranquil escape from the town's bustling center. The temple features a beautifully decorated ordination hall and various Buddha statues.

Local tips
- Dress modestly when visiting the temple to respect local customs.
- Visit early in the morning to witness the monks' rituals and enjoy a quieter atmosphere.
- Take your time to explore the temple grounds and admire the intricate details of the architecture.

Getting There
-
Walking
Wat Kang is located in the northern part of Vang Vieng town, approximately 950 meters walking distance from the Vang Vieng Southern Bus Terminal. From the town center, walk north towards the Nam Song River. The temple is easily accessible on foot and is a short walk from most guesthouses and hotels.
-
Tuk-tuk
Tuk-tuks are readily available in Vang Vieng and are a convenient way to reach Wat Kang. A short tuk-tuk ride within the town typically costs around 10,000 to 15,000 LAK per person. Negotiate the price before starting your journey.
